🥘 Ingredients

6 items
  • 1 piece Whole wheat tortilla
  • 2 tablespoons Peanut butter
  • 1 medium Apple
  • 1 teaspoon Honey
  • 2 tablespoons Granola
  • 0.25 teaspoon Ground cinnamon

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Lay the whole wheat tortilla flat on a clean surface or a plate.

2

Spread the peanut butter evenly across the tortilla, leaving about half an inch of space around the edges.

3

Wash and core the apple, then cut it into thin slices.

4

Arrange the apple slices in a single layer on top of the peanut butter.

5

Drizzle the honey evenly over the apple slices.

6

Sprinkle the granola over the apples for a crunchy texture.

7

Dust with ground cinnamon to add a warm, spiced flavor.

8

Fold in the sides of the tortilla slightly, then roll it up tightly from one end to the other to form a wrap.

9

Slice the wrap in half, if desired, and serve immediately or wrap tightly in foil for later.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(286.9g)
Calories
555
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 25.3 g 32%
Saturated Fat 6.4 g 32%
Polyunsaturated Fat 4.6 g
Cholesterol 0 mg 0%
Sodium 318 mg 14%
Total Carbohydrate 71.5 g 26%
Dietary Fiber 12.0 g 43%
Total Sugars 35.4 g
Protein 14.4 g 29%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 165 mg 13%
Iron 2.6 mg 14%
Potassium 588 mg 13%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
